Understanding Customized Steel Manufacture Fundamentals



Exploring the principles of personalized steel manufacture offers insight right into the complex process of transforming raw steel into customized architectural parts. Customized steel construction is a customized manufacturing method that entails cutting, shaping, and constructing steel products to develop distinct frameworks according to particular task requirements. Recognizing the fundamentals of personalized steel manufacture is critical for making sure the effective implementation of architectural jobs.


The procedure usually begins with the evaluation of task specifications and layout demands. This initial stage entails comprehensive preparation and partnership in between designers, producers, and designers to figure out the most suitable approach for fabricating the steel components. Accuracy is essential during the fabrication process, as also minor discrepancies can influence the structural honesty of the last item.


Various techniques, such as reducing, welding, and shaping, are utilized to transform raw steel right into the desired structural aspects. Proficient producers make use of innovative machinery and tools to ensure accuracy and uniformity throughout the manufacture procedure. Quality control measures are applied to verify the honesty of the fabricated parts prior to they are assembled on-site, making certain compliance with market standards and project specs.

Quality Assurance and Job Management in Steel Construction



To make certain the successful implementation of steel manufacture tasks, precise quality assurance actions and reliable job monitoring practices are crucial components in keeping accuracy and meeting client expectations. Quality assurance in steel manufacture entails strenuous assessments at numerous stages of the fabrication process to verify conformity with job specs and sector requirements. This includes product screening, dimensional checks, and weld evaluations to guarantee architectural integrity and safety and security.


Job management plays an essential role in working with the different elements of steel fabrication tasks, such as organizing, source appropriation, and interaction amongst group participants. A distinct task strategy with clear objectives, turning points, and timelines aids to check development and address any kind of potential issues proactively. Reliable communication in between all stakeholders, consisting of customers, designers, professionals, and fabricators, is vital for guaranteeing that the project advances efficiently and meets the desired top quality criteria.
